Putin’s Hucksters. How Russia Stole and Bankrupted Melitopol Auto and Tractor Parts Plant

The Center for Journalist Investigations launches the new series of investigative stories about Russian war crimes on occupied territories of Ukraine. We will uncover what happened with the largest Ukrainian industrial and agricultural companies, stolen by Russia, after four years of the Russian occupation of Southern Ukraine.

We start with Saint Petersburg company «MDK». It accumulated assets of four large plants of temporarily occupied parts of Zaporizhzhia oblast. One of them is Melitopol Auto and Tractor Parts Plant. Before Russian occupation and expropriation, it has been leading foundry of Southern Ukraine. Russian occupants put it on the edge of bankruptcy (watch video version of the story here).

Crimean Tatar Singer Jamala, Former Parliamentarian Kotelyak and Public Official Falush, Russian Oligarch Churkin. Whose Assets Russian Occupants Expropriated?

«State Council» of occupied Crimea has illegally expropriated assets of 112 Ukrainian companies and citizens for their «cooperation» with the Armed Forces of Ukraine. The Center of Journalist Investigations studied the list of expropriated assets and found out a lot of interesting facts. Information about «double» or hidden life of some Ukrainian politicians and businessmen was disclosed.
